How to pick a versatile macro lens for close up photography that balances working distance and sharpness.

When shopping for a versatile macro lens, start by defining your typical subjects and shooting distances. Consider whether you’ll photograph tiny insects, flowers, jewelry, or textures that demand varying working distances. A longer minimum focusing distance often lets you stay farther away, reducing the risk of startling shy subjects and improving light control. Equally important is resolving power: you want enough magnification to reveal micro-textures without sacrificing edge sharpness in the frame. Evaluate how the lens renders color, contrast, and micro-contrast as distance to the subject shifts. This early planning helps you avoid lenses that are excellent for one scenario but limited in others.
Next, examine optical design fundamentals that influence performance across close focus ranges. Macro zooms can provide flexibility, yet they often compromise sharpness at the extreme magnifications. Prime macro lenses tend to deliver superior edge-to-edge sharpness and better control of aberrations, especially at wider apertures. Look for coatings that minimize flare in sunlit garden scenes or indoors under strong lighting. Pay attention to coma and distortion in corner regions, as these affect high-detail subjects near the frame edges. A well-balanced combination of focal length, working distance, and optical quality helps ensure consistent results across a broad spectrum of close-up tasks.
Choose configurations that harmonize distance, brightness, and clarity.
When evaluating focal lengths, remember that 90mm to 105mm are common sweet spots for either DX or full-frame cameras. A longer lens affords more working distance, which is beneficial for skittish subjects and studio setups with lighting rigs. However, longer designs can become financially and physically heavier, and close-focusing limits may tighten. Shorter macro lenses provide faster handling and easier travel-friendly setups, but require you to be much closer to your subject, increasing the risk of shadowing or subject disturbance. Determine whether you prioritize distance or convenience, and choose accordingly. Real-world use often reveals the best compromise for your kit.

Aperture choice matters as much as focal length. A lens with a bright maximum aperture grants more light, enabling faster shutter speeds and shallower depth of field control for selective focus aesthetics. Yet peering at tiny details through very wide apertures can exaggerate spherical aberrations at the edges. If you frequently shoot in dim environments, a lens with strong mid-range performance at f/4 or f/5.6 offers a practical balance between brightness and depth resolution. In bright daylight, stopping down to around f/8 or f/11 can sharpen micro-textures while preserving reasonable contrast. Test different apertures on the subjects you shoot most to understand practical limits.
Focus accuracy and subject distance define macro versatility.
Image stabilization is another critical factor when you’re handholding macro work. Starlit nights, dim studio corners, or waiting for subject motion can all benefit from stabilization, especially at closer focus distances. If your body of work involves tripod-based setups, stabilization might be less vital, but the ability to shoot handheld with minimal motion blur remains a real advantage. Modern lenses often pair optical stabilization with camera-based stabilization for combined effects. Confirm how the two systems interact and whether stabilization impacts focusing performance. A well-integrated approach helps you sustain sharpness across a range of angles and distances.

Autofocus performance in macro settings deserves careful attention as well. Some macro lenses prioritize manual focus feel, offering precise control but slower operation. Others deliver fast, reliable autofocus, which is helpful for moving subjects or spontaneous studio scenes. Consider the lens’s minimum focusing distance in combination with its autofocus tracking behavior. In routine practice, a responsive AF system reduces the need for constant manual tweaks, letting you capture fleeting moments, texture changes, or subtle color shifts with confidence. If you shoot macro in bursts, test how quickly and quietly the focus mechanism reacquires lock when framing shifts.

Build quality and ergonomics influence long-term satisfaction more than most expect. A robust, weather-sealed body helps you work outdoors in varying conditions, protecting optics from dust, humidity, and light rain. The lens should also balance well on your camera body to minimize fatigue during extended sessions. Consider grip texture, smooth focus rings, and the distance scale. Practical design details—like a dedicated macro switch, a manual focus clutch, or a configurable control ring—can streamline your workflow dramatically. Even small touches, such as a precise, tactile zoom or focus clutch, contribute to consistent results during detailed close-ups.
Compatibility matters beyond initial fit. Ensure your chosen macro lens plays nicely with your existing kit, including extension tubes, bellows, or stacked lenses if you ever plan more extreme magnification. Some lenses display improved sharpness when used with reverse-mounted adapters or macro-specific accessories, but not all bodies tolerate these configurations well. Also verify that coatings and glass elements won’t inadvertently introduce color shifts with your preferred lighting setups. Finally, check that your lens’s autofocus and metering behavior remains stable when adapters are introduced. A versatile system should keep performance predictable across a variety of accessory configurations.

Lighting strategy is essential when working with macro gear. Because you’re working at close distances, natural light can be strong and directional, creating harsh shadows or blown highlights. On overcast days, diffuse light helps preserve texture without overwhelming contrasts. Many macro shooters rely on ring flashes or twin-head setups to distribute even illumination, but these can introduce flatness if not carefully controlled. Consider a combination of diffusers, reflectors, and practical light sources to sculpt micro textures. Experiment with light angles, distance, and intensity to reveal subtle surface details. A good lighting plan makes edge sharpness pop without distracting highlights.
Reflecting on subject interaction improves results across subjects. Insects, flowers, minerals, and textiles each respond differently to light and perspective. Insects may require a gentle approach and a slower working rhythm, while flowers respond to natural, studio-like illumination that emphasizes color depth. For textured subjects like minerals, you may prefer cooler, high-contrast lighting to highlight striations. Documenting a few test setups helps you map how your lens and lighting interact at various distances. Over time, you’ll build a repertoire of ready-to-use setups that consistently deliver crisp macro results with balanced working distance.
Real-world testing offers clarity that spec sheets cannot capture. Take your potential macro lens into environments you shoot most often, varying subject types, distances, and lighting conditions. Compare edge sharpness across frame corners at multiple magnifications, and note any color shifts or vignetting under different lighting. A robust test includes close work at the closest focusing distance plus a few steps back to verify performance across the practical range. Record your observations with sample images and sketches so you can reference them later. The goal is to choose a lens that consistently delivers reliable sharpness and working distance for your everyday workflow.
In the end, the best macro lens is the one that fits your technique and budget while maintaining faithful image quality. Prioritize models that offer a healthy working distance, solid sharpness across the frame, and dependable autofocus in common scenarios. Don’t overlook ergonomic comfort and compatibility with your accessories; these choices often determine whether you actually use the lens regularly. Consider renting or borrowing a candidate lens to assess real-world handling before purchase. With the right balance of distance and clarity, your close-up photography becomes more expressive, precise, and enjoyable, expanding what you can reveal to viewers.
